What a general dentist can do
General dentists spend their days performing a wide range of treatments and procedures, all in service of keeping people’s smiles healthy and vibrant. The most common services that a patient can expect when visiting the dentist include the following.
Cleaning the teeth
Perhaps the task that the dentist is most known for, a tooth cleaning is a standard part of a dental checkup. They will use specialized tools, such as polishers and scalers, to remove plaque and tartar on the teeth. This buildup cannot be removed at home with a normal toothbrush, which is why visiting the dentist is crucial.
A tooth cleaning removes bacteria on the teeth and helps keep them smooth, so new bacteria will have a harder time clinging to them. It can also preserve their color to keep the smile bright.
Treating gingivitis
Almost all adults will either experience gingivitis at some point in their lives or know someone who has it. Gingivitis, also called gum disease, occurs when the gums become inflamed due to bacteria in the mouth. Most often, this arises due to insufficient oral hygiene habits.
General dentists treat gingivitis through regular tooth cleaning and potentially, more targeted procedures, such as scaling and root planing. They may clean gum pockets or provide antiseptic mouthwash to assist patients in overcoming their gum disease.
Fixing cavities
Cavities present as weakened areas of enamel on the teeth. A general dentist can fix a cavity by drilling away the decayed tissue and replacing it with a strong, hard filling made of materials like composite or amalgam. When caught early, most cavities can be fixed with minimal effort and without compromising the health of the tooth.
Identifying oral cancers
During a regular checkup, general dentists typically use their fingers to gently feel the patient's neck and tongue or probe around the cheeks. This process aims to detect early signs of oral cancers. The earlier that the dentist notices an issue, the more likely the patient is to make a full recovery.
Administering fluoride treatments
After the general dentist has finished the tooth cleaning process, they may apply a fluoride treatment, usually by coating the patient's teeth in a special liquid for a minute or two. The fluoride helps strengthen the teeth and keep them strong against decay. Once the treatment is over, the patient only needs to rinse their mouth before going on their way.
